html onclick
时间: 2023-07-01 08:05:33 浏览: 102
`onclick` 是一个 HTML 属性,它用于在用户单击某个元素(例如按钮、超链接等)时触发 JavaScript 函数。当用户单击元素时,浏览器会执行 `onclick` 属性中指定的 JavaScript 代码。
例如,以下是一个在单击按钮时触发函数的示例:
```
<button onclick="myFunction()">点击我</button>
<script>
function myFunction() {
alert("Hello World!");
}
</script>
```
当用户单击按钮时,就会弹出一个警告框显示 "Hello World!"。
相关问题
html onclick用法
HTML onclick是一种事件属性,用于在元素被点击时执行JavaScript代码。它可以在HTML元素上直接使用,例如按钮,链接等。以下是HTML onclick用法的示例:
```html
<button onclick="alert('Hello World!')">点击我</button>
```
在上面的示例中,当用户单击按钮时,将弹出一个警告框,其中包含文本“Hello World!”。您可以使用onclick属性来调用任何JavaScript函数,而不仅限于警告框。例如:
```html
<button onclick="myFunction()">点击我</button>
<script>
function myFunction() {
alert("Hello World!");
}
</script>
```
在上面的示例中,当用户单击按钮时,将调用名为myFunction()的JavaScript函数,并弹出一个警告框,其中包含文本“Hello World!”。
html onclick没用
您好!对于HTML中的"onclick"属性,它通常用于执行JavaScript代码,以响应用户的点击事件。如果您在使用"onclick"属性时遇到问题,可能有以下几个原因导致它似乎无效:
1. 语法错误:请确保您的JavaScript代码正确无误,并且没有任何语法错误。可以通过在浏览器控制台检查是否有错误提示来排除该问题。
2. 元素选择问题:请检查您使用"onclick"属性的元素是否正确选择。可能是由于选择器错误或元素不存在而导致点击事件无效。
3. JavaScript引用问题:如果您在HTML中引用外部的JavaScript文件,请确保文件路径正确,并且没有错误。
4. 其他事件处理程序:如果您同时使用多个事件处理程序,例如"onclick"和"onsubmit"等,可能存在事件冲突或覆盖的情况。请检查您的代码是否正确处理了这些情况。
如果以上解决方法都无效,建议您提供更多详细信息,以便我能够更准确地帮助您解决问题。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)